[UPDATE 2 p.m. Some Resources Being Released] Fire in the Benbow Area

Reed Fire

Smoke boils up near Reed Mountain. [Photo from a reader]

Multiple fire crews are attempting to make access to a fire in the Benbow area near or on Reed Mountain. Overhead spotter planes are racing to the scene as of 12:45 p.m.

UPDATE 12:55 p.m.: Firefighters are now looking for Red Rock Road. Personnel with eyes on the fire describes it as 1/4 acre in heavy timber with a slow rate of spread.

UPDATE 1 p.m.: Now dispatch is saying that the best access is likely off of Twin Trees Road.

UPDATE 1:07 p.m.: A reader tells us, “Spotter planes on it. Heli on scene…Wind picking up. Smoke plume solid up to 3000ft.”

UPDATE 1:39 p.m.: A campground in Richardson Grove State Park is being evacuated because of the fire.

UPDATE 1:42 p.m.: Below is the rough area of the fire.

UPDATE 1:46 p.m.: A reader tells us that planes are circling overhead.
Plane circling fire
UPDATE 1:58 p.m.: A reader tells us that the smoke from the fire is getting less noticeable.

UPDATE 2 p.m.: Fire is holding at approximately one acre. Some resources are being released.

Only one fire was found. As Suzanne mentions, the original caller to the Fortuna Command Center, calling from somewhere on Alderpoint Road, estimated from his location that the fire was “in the Benbow area” possibly near Reed Mountain.

When the Air Attack plane (fire aircraft coordinator) arrived overhead he corrected the location to be farther west (and south) of that, saying it didn’t appear to have any good road access, but the best possibly being via Twin Trees Road near Richardson Grove.

Distances and directions can always be tricky in the mountains, of course.
